Studies on the Lipid Components of Ginkgo Nut


Abstract
Lipids, extracted with chloroform-methanol (2:1 by vol.) and purified, from nut and leaf of Ginkgo biloba were identified and quantitatived by column, thin layer and gas liquid chromatography. The results were summarized as follow:
1) The total content of purified lipids in the nut and leaf on the fresh weight basis were 1.32% and 2.24%, respectively.
2) The lipid fractions in the nut obtained by silicic acid colum chromatography were found to be composed of about 89% neutral lipids and about 10% compound lipids, and in the leaf were found to be composed of about 28% neutral lipids and about 72% compound lipids.
3) Among the neutral lipid fractions, triglycerides (86.2%) were the major component in the nut, but esterified sterols (53.3%) were the major component in the leaf.
4) The main fatty acids of the total lipids were oleic(37.5%) and linoleic acid(44.5%) in the nut, but linolenic(45.2%) and palmitic acid (25.1%) were main fatty acids in the leaf. The patterns of fatty acid composition of the neutral lipid fractions in the nut and leaf were found to be similar, and oleic, linoleic and palmitic acid were the predominant.
A large amount of oleic and linoleic acid in the glycolipid fractions was found in the nut compared with those in the leaf, but linolenic acid content in the leaf was significantly higher than in the nut. And patterns of fatty acid composition of the phospholipid fractions in the nut and leaf were found to be similar to that of glycolipid fractions.
